Our work with the Mountjoy Prison Maynooth University Partnership focused on creating a strategic plan to enhance educational opportunities for students with criminal justice histories, within both the prison and the University. This involved a comprehensive assessment of the partnership’s current governance, enabling them to identify their most effective structure and set specific, impactful objectives.

We supported the development of a roadmap that promotes educational access and community resilience, drawing on best practice in the science of learning and teaching and responding to the challenges of managing educational programmes in prison.

For the Universities of Sanctuary Ireland Steering Group, we facilitated a series of in-depth discussions to define their vision for the next 3-5 years. Through breakout sessions, we examined critical operational areas such as outreach, scholarship programs, and policy advocacy, ensuring that UoSI is positioned to advance the Sanctuary movement within Ireland’s higher education sector and respond to national and international developments.

We helped establish a new governance model for Universities of Sanctuary Ireland that supports their commitment to inclusion and advocacy within the higher education system while maximising the benefits from a large and diverse voluntary membership.
